Information on a new bottle book called Bottled in Illinois, all color photos, 792 pages and only bottles from 1840 to 1880, I bought two copies this evening from Jeff Cress, Edwardsville, Illinois!
Special copies will be available at the Eastside Antique Bottle, Jar & Brewery Colectibles 5th Annual Show & Sale.
